What was Alexander McQueen design style?

Key elements of McQueen’s aesthetic include: Roman Gothic/Victorian-inspired pieces, like dark colors, thick fabrics, and red lace. Frequent references to armor or pieces that are “protective” of the woman wearing them. Highly sophisticated tailoring, stemming from his background on Savile Row.

What techniques does Alexander McQueen use?

As one can see in Savage Beauty, McQueen often used traditional craft techniques such as embroidery, lace making, and metalworking to create his radically modern designs. Opting most commonly for embellished, ornamented surfaces, he used printed or woven textiles only very rarely.

What did Alexander McQueen do for fashion?

He founded his own Alexander McQueen label in 1992, and was chief designer at Givenchy from 1996 to 2001. His achievements in fashion earned him four British Designer of the Year awards (1996, 1997, 2001 and 2003), as well as the CFDA’s International Designer of the Year award in 2003.

What are Alexander McQueen’s made of?

Instead of metal, McQueen chose other materials. He made breastplates from plaster of Paris, leather and Perspex. For fashion curator Andrew Bolton, the McQueen cuirass that best captures the “tragic, poetic beauty” of his designs is one made of glass: a stunning object but a self-defeating form of armour.

Who built Atlantis?

Plato told the story of Atlantis around 360 B.C. The founders of Atlantis, he said, were half god and half human. They created a utopian civilization and became a great naval power. Their home was made up of concentric islands separated by wide moats and linked by a canal that penetrated to the center.
